When looking at our statsd data in graphite, the graphs are saying the current time is two hours in the future. For instance, if we're looking at graphite at 9:00am, the graphs are telling us it's 11:00am. The data lines up like it should--if we had 99 events at 9:00am, we can see the 99 events on the graphs at 11:00am.

The clock is correct on the host running statsd, and we tried stopping & starting the statsd process. Any other suggestions on where to look to fix that?

Fixed by creating this file (since we're in California)

$ cat /opt/graphite/webapp/graphite/local_settings.py

# Set your local timezone (django will *try* to figure this out automatically)
# If your graphs appear to be offset by a couple hours then this probably
# needs to be explicitly set to your local timezone.
TIME_ZONE = 'America/Los_Angeles'
